Output 5129bb65404987f1b26fa5cbda4e5aac8d0f8f9aad25c1e659da8c9834e97596:0

value
20936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768442347bdc72a5548044f11c81cd006c8595c7 OP_EQUAL
address
3CVg6fmnGHy7ny4TDwFinyDY9StpaxDVyW
transaction
5129bb65404987f1b26fa5cbda4e5aac8d0f8f9aad25c1e659da8c9834e97596
confirmations
513080
spent
true